The tower formerly carried a conventional lantern room. Located on a tiny waveswept rock off the northern entrance to the harbor of Saint-Pierre. Accessible only by boat. Site and tower closed.

| Light Character | flash every 2 s, red or white depending on direction. |
| Lighthouse Markings | 12 m (39 ft) round solid masonry tower, painted white with a horizontal red band; the small lantern is also red. |
| Management Body Ports Authority | government of St.-Pierre et Miquelon. |
